I went to Mimuroto Temple to see the hydrangeas.
It was a weekend and the weather was very nice, so there were a lot of people.
It's about a 15-minute walk from Keihan Mimuroto Station.

First, please go to the main hall.
The stairs are steep, but the view is spectacular.
There are several limited-time goshuin stamps.

Some hydrangea varieties are in bloom, while others are yet to bloom. I think you can still enjoy it this weekend.
It's a shame that the tea shop that was in the hydrangea garden last year wasn't there this year...
It seems that you can get hydrangea parfaits and hydrangea parfait ice bars at the nearby Ito Kyuemon (there was a sign at the intersection), so it's worth stopping by on your way home 🥰
